Molecular Structure of Linalyl phenylacetate (CAS NO.93572-42-0):
IUPAC Name: 3,7-dimethylocta-1,6-dien-3-yl 2-phenylacetate
Empirical Formula: C18H24O2
Molecular Weight: 272.382
Index of Refraction: 1.509
Surface Tension: 33.8 dyne/cm
Density: 0.975 g/cm3
Flash Point: 106.5 °C
Enthalpy of Vaporization: 59.03 kJ/mol
Boiling Point: 346.2 °C at 760 mmHg
Vapour Pressure: 5.87E-05 mmHg at 25°C

1. | orl-rat LD50:>5 g/kg | FCTXAV Food and Cosmetics Toxicology. 14 (1976),465. | ||
2. | skn-rbt LD50:>5 g/kg | FCTXAV Food and Cosmetics Toxicology. 14 (1976),465. |
Reported in EPA TSCA Inventory.
Low toxicity by ingestion and skin contact. A combustible liquid. When heated to decomposition it emits acrid smoke and irritating vapors.
